A Final Choice

The shadow of darkness casts a spell over me.
It finds me in the night with no offer of sympathy.
Fondling me caressing me, holding me fearful close
An evil presence clearly noted, while Satan boasts.

Triumphant in your endeavours, you are the king of beasts,
Grasping deadly pleasure of which your body feasts.
You tower over the weak and sneak beneath the strong.
Reaching to the depths, watching good bodies drown..

Oh the earth dost rumble while fire blasts away.
Coven doors stay open as you find your easy prey.
You come as a beautiful Angel, so shiek and cavalier,
Hidden truths lie dormant, as you penetrate with fear.

As the evil deeds are done for the masters' heavy hand.
Used up pieces of flesh, shrivel as you planned.
Fear not! ! ! The doors will open, the light will shine through.
A decision must be made………………………
Do I choose Him or do I choose you.
